Two particles which are initially at rest, move towards each other under the action of their internal attraction. If their speeds are v and 2v at any instant, then the speed of centre of mass of the system will be:

Options

(a) 2v
(b) zero
(c) 1.5
(d) v

Correct Answer:

zero

Explanation:

If no external force actson a system of particles, the centre of mass remains as rest. So, speed of centre of mass is zero.
